Can i ask where you got your front mount kit and what size your FMIC is? and just to clarify it didn't come like that lol? (chops and joins everywhere)

Mine needed similar treatment but i thought it was cause i'm fitting a gc8 kit to a be5

just to let you know we only actually cut the supplied kit in 2 places - where it was approx 3-4cm too short / to make it fit nicer... - this was on the sides at the front of the car.

the kit itself has some neat welds in it where they obviously couldn't bend / angle the kit without them... they are very tidy and well made. the redline kit is modeled off the hks kit, it comes supplied in 4 big pieces, we ended up with 6... not a major if you ask me as we only needed to cut to add afew cm in length. The cooler is 600 x 300 - but the cooler im using isnt the one that came with the kit - we are saving that for another special project.

hopefully this all makes sense... and doesnt come across as a bitchy reply - because its not.
